The Big Wheel (1949)
Roaring at you with mile-a-minute thrills!
The ambitious son of an accomplished race driver struggles to outrun his father's legacy and achieve his own successes.
Director: Edward Ludwig
Genre: Action, Drama, Romance
Runtime: 92 min
Release Date: November 4, 1949
Cast
- Mickey Rooney - Billy Coy
- Thomas Mitchell - Arthur 'Red' Stanley
- Michael O'Shea - Vic Sullivan
- Mary Hatcher - Louise Riley
- Spring Byington - Mary Coy
- Steve Brodie - Happy Lee
- Lina Romay - Dolores Raymond
- Hattie McDaniel - Minnie
- Allen Jenkins - George
- Monte Blue - Deacon Jones
Screenplay
- Robert Smith (Screenplay)
Cinematography: Ernest Laszlo
Production: Samuel H. Stiefel Productions, United Artists
Country: United States of America
Language: English
